Hey everyone. it is me and my problems and questions.

See, in previous DA games, there was no need for you to be logged in to Origin in order to sign in to your account and actually sync your account. So basically I could log in in the game whenever I wanted to my origin/through origin and upload my progress and stuff. Now here, to use the keep and transfer the world state created, we need to sign in to origin/game servers in the game. Here is the problem. As I said, previously we did not need to logged in to origin in order to log in through/in the game and stuff that I said, but now it keeps telling me you should be logged in to origin to connect to the servers. So I can not use the keep even though I have three made world state. I do not have origin but do have an origin account (or I would have not been able to create world states). And for some reasons, I rather not. any help on this logging in issue would be appreciated.

You can't play the game without Origin (unless you pirated it)

 

Un-install the game and then Origin. Then re-install origin, logging in with the account used to purchase DA:I and then install the game and log into the same account. (You had to do this on DA:O and DA2 as well)
